Transaction 2bec4ccb4c6f571260ee71abf0fd96670f1b25ec8d087b9c989344cfbb505481
1 Input
1 Output
-
2bec4ccb4c6f571260ee71abf0fd96670f1b25ec8d087b9c989344cfbb505481:0
- value
- 536258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c38677861b88fee24fbf3afb47c1597cf3c76d8 OP_EQUAL
- address
- 34GEQwqCudvtJFPfg6zpXMVxK7GPKkDG4M